Trump Wishes Christians And Catholics A ‘Peaceful And Prayerful’ Ash Wednesday

President Donald Trump wished Christians and Catholics a “peaceful and prayerful” start to the Christian Lenten season Wednesday.

The president issued a Wednesday statement in which he wished “everyone observing Ash Wednesday a peaceful and prayerful day.”

“For Catholics and many other Christians, Ash Wednesday marks the beginning of the Lenten season that concludes with the joyful celebration of Easter Sunday,” the president said in a statement.
